Responsibilities:
- Assess and develop information requirements for new and existing products
- Execute the development of documentation, including: silicon and IP data sheets; architecture specifications; application notes; hardware and embedded firmware user manuals and white papers
- Evaluate and resolve information-related bugs across all potentially affected sources
- Contribute to the definition and implementation of methodologies to heighten visibility of documentation status and issues; streamline documentation production and release; and improve integration with the silicon design flow and multi-functional use of design information
- Review technical information for content, quality, and alignment to defined standards and requirements
- Connect with internal customers/stakeholders regarding documentation-related issues and commitments
Required Skills and Qualifications:
- Experience in information development/documentation for silicon products
- Experience using Adobe FrameMaker, Oxygen XML Editor, and other DITA XML tools
- Experience using and configuring version control systems, bug tracking systems, content management/database systems
- Ability to address and prioritize immediate tactical needs while maintaining a broader customer enablement approach
- Direct oral and written customer interaction
- Strong problem-solving skills
- Very strong ability to collaborate within a cross-functional product team
- Self-discipline to balance/context switch in order to support multiple simultaneous projects and deadlines
- Ability to clearly define abstract problems and develop concise and actionable solutions
- Bachelor’s degree in Electrical or Computer Engineering with experience in a semiconductor tech writing, applications or systems engineering role
Preferred Skills and Qualifications:
- Experience using and developing structured data content (e.g., XML, IP-XACT, DITA)
- Automation and scripting capabilities (e.g., Python, Perl, ExtendScript, XSLT)
- Mixed-signal hardware and audio-related background
- Hands-on hardware and/or software experience
- Analog, digital, and mixed-signal fundamentals
- Atlassian Confluence
- Microsoft Visio
- Automation using Jenkins, CI (Continuous Integration) pipelines

What We Do
Cirrus Logic is a leading supplier of low-power, high-precision mixed-signal processing solutions for mobile and consumer applications. The company has a robust portfolio of sophisticated low-power products, including boosted amplifiers, smart codecs, camera controllers, haptic driver and sensing solutions, power conversion and control Integrated Circuits, and fast-charging Integrated Circuits. These solutions have innovative technology, software and associated algorithms incorporated. With a strong intellectual property portfolio and extensive mixed-signal expertise, Cirrus Logic is well-positioned to drive innovation and growth in the evolving markets of audio and high-performance mixed-signal processing technologies.
